Default pictures of my damaged CC DS

These are pictures of a damaged Club Car I purchused from a neighbor. A tree limb fell on it and smashed the seat, seat back, control box and cover, micro switches, fiberglass body, solinoid, and spark plug coil. I've got it repaired and running again. Here are some pictures of the damaged body. I'll take some pictures of the repairs I've made and upload them tomorrow.

called the cart dealer out here local he said usually 125 for used rear bodys but they didnt have any instock for gas. he had new take off bodys for 175 which i still might do. good deal. best bet is to call your local dealer. quick question does your cart have 2 aluminum verticals and a piece of angle on it at the front under the sear thats the hinges srew to? i was just looking at a buddies cart and his has this. mine doesnt seems like if i had it it would of held up alot better!
